Job summary

The City of New York, Office of Child Support Services (OCSS), is recruiting for a Clerical Associate III to function as the Scheduling Unit Supervisor. This role will supervise clerical staff, manage work assignments, and ensure coverage for all clerical activities.

Under the Office Manager, you will use systems like FRED, NYCWAY, ASSETS, WMS, ECFS, and CS TRACK, handle inquiries, compile reports, and train staff while maintaining accurate rosters and inventory controls.

Qualifications

  • A four-year high school diploma or its educational equivalent approved by a State's department of education or a recognized accrediting organization and one year of satisfactory clerical experience.
  • Keyboard familiarity with the ability to type at a minimum of 100 key strokes (20 words) per minute.
  • This position is open to qualified persons with a disability under the 55-a Program; indicate interest on resume/cover letter.

Responsibilities

  • Supervise and schedule work assignments to all clerical support staff; ensures coverage for all clerical activities.
  • Review and update client appointments and walk-ins using systems such as FRED, NYCWAY, ASSETS, WMS, ECFS, CS TRACK, etc.; conduct scanning/indexing as needed.
  • Answer and respond to telephone calls regarding scheduled appointments, sanctions and inquiries; refer callers to other departments as appropriate.
  • Process hard and electronic mail & faxes, including CS Track; maintain daily/weekly statistics and rosters for case management.
  • Provide staff training and feedback on policies/procedures; monitor time and leave and rate subordinates' performance.
  • Assist with office inventory and materials; support annual inventory protocol; provide coverage for clerical tasks as needed.
